Moscow–Caracas Conviasa Flight Reappears on Schedule for Jan. 5 After Earlier Cancellation
Airport listings indicate the service may run despite Venezuela's state of emergency.
Overview
- Vnukovo's online board lists Conviasa flight V0771 to Caracas departing at 11:00 MSK on Jan. 5 with check-in opening at 06:00.
- The Airbus A340 slated for the route is scheduled to arrive in Moscow from Guangzhou at 08:30 MSK on the day of departure.
- A TASS air-traffic source and Vnukovo's information service said the flight may be operated as scheduled.
- The service had been marked canceled earlier, and Russian tour operators reported refunds are unavailable during holiday bank closures, offering rebooking or paid alternatives.
- Reports say Caracas's Simón Bolívar International Airport has resumed handling passenger flights following U.S. strikes and Venezuela's emergency declaration.
